How to remove front and rear bumper Peugeot 301 (Citroen C-Elysee)


-open the hood.
-under the hood, under the hood, Unscrew the screws that secure the trim and the top.
-we release the upper part from the latches.
-on the perimeter of the lower part, Unscrew the screws (spun up).
-turn the wheels to the side.
-in the wheel wells, Unscrew the screws and release the fender liner.

-for the fender liner, Unscrew the screws that secure the corners of the bumper to the wings.
-we release the corners in the wings.
-with an assistant, gently pull the bumper forward (be careful not to break the wires).
-remove electrical connectors (if any).

Rear bumper




-Open the trunk lid.
-remove the rear lights.
-on the perimeter of the lower part, Unscrew the screws (spun up).
-in the wheel wells, Unscrew the screws that secure the fender liner.
-(if any) Unscrew the screws that secure the corners of the bumper to the wings.

-we release the latches in the wings (pull the corners down and towards you), under the rear lights in the trunk opening.
-with an assistant, remove the bumper back (be careful not to break the wires).
-remove connectors from electrical equipment.
